MetaTrader 4 Build 529 ベータ版リリース、新コンパイラー搭載 - ページ 86

 
VOLDEMAR:

みんな、理解できないし、今のヘルプは誤解を招くよ...。

私のヘルプにあるこれらの例は、新しいコンパイラで動作するのでしょうか?

mt5のようなボタンを作成することは可能でしょうか?

私たちは書きました - ヘルプはまだ確定していません。とりあえず旧バージョンをお使いください。
 

MT4 (build 509)のObjectFind関数

int ObjectFind( string name)

MT5での機能。

int ObjectFind( long chart_id, const string object_name)

552年でもまだ変化なし

 
pro_:

MT4 (build 509)のObjectFind関数。

MT5での機能。

552でもまだ変化なし。


これは対処しているところです。

近日公開予定

 
素晴らしい。じゃあ、また書いてごめんね。
 
evillive:
言ったでしょ、ヘルプはまだ確定していないんです。とりあえず旧バージョンをお使いください。


初期のページには、「いろいろなものが後から追加される」と書いてありましたが、その通りだと思います。

そこで、すべての機能がすでに実装され動作しているのか、それとも何か追加されるのかを知りたいのですが?

 
//+------------------------------------------------------------------+
//|                                                Color_Buffers.mq4 |
//|                        Copyright 2013, MetaQuotes Software Corp. |
//|                                              https://www.mql5.com |
//+------------------------------------------------------------------+
#property copyright "Copyright 2013, MetaQuotes Software Corp."
#property link      "https://www.mql5.com"
#property version   "1.00"
#property strict
#property indicator_chart_window

#property indicator_buffers 4
#property indicator_color1 Blue
#property indicator_color2 Red

//#property indicator_color3 Blue
//#property indicator_color4 Red

double ExtUpperBuffer[];
double ExtLowerBuffer[];

double MinBuffer[];
double MaxBuffer[];

//+------------------------------------------------------------------+
//| Custom indicator initialization function                         |
//+------------------------------------------------------------------+
int init()
  {
//--- indicator buffers mapping
    IndicatorBuffers(4);
//---- 4 распределенных буфера индикатора
    SetIndexBuffer(0,ExtUpperBuffer);
    SetIndexBuffer(1,ExtLowerBuffer);
    
    SetIndexBuffer(2,MinBuffer);
    SetIndexBuffer(3,MaxBuffer);
//---
    return(0);
  }
//+------------------------------------------------------------------+
//| Custom indicator deinitialization function                       |
//+------------------------------------------------------------------+
int deinit()
  {
//----
   
//----
   return(0);
  }
//+------------------------------------------------------------------+
//| Custom indicator iteration function                              |
//+------------------------------------------------------------------+
int start()
  {
   int counted_bars=IndicatorCounted();
   return(0);
  }

Bild 553, ME 876。シンプルなデザインで、色3と色4を閉じると、こんな絵になります。

 
ヘルプが更新されたのは良いのですが、ボタンとOnChartEventが まだなのが残念です。
 

もしかしたら、すでにそうなっているかもしれません。

IN ME。スクロールしているマウスを任意の場所(カーソルがウィンドウ内にない場所)にドラッグすると、コンパイル後にスクロールがカーソルに移動します。そしてこれは、開いている すべてのファイルで発生します。

わかりやすくするために、いくつかのファイルを開いてその中の何か(関数や変数)を見るために、右のスライダーをある場所までスクロールさせたとします(カーソルは最初にとどまります)。そして何かをコンパイルすると、開いているすべてのファイルがカーソル(私の場合はファイルの先頭)に戻ってきます。そして、それらを適切な場所にスクロールして戻す必要があります。

 
ALXIMIKS:
ヘルプを更新してくれたのは嬉しいが、ボタンとOnChartEventがまだ作られていないのが残念だ。


今日、ボタンを作ろうとしたら、うまくいったようです

 
VOLDEMAR:


今日、ボタンを作ってみたら、うまくいったようです。


オブジェクトの 作成順やハイライト 表示全般、説明文に問題があるんです。